Fixed Fee Service for Application Only
We offer a fixed fee service for application only matters, whether this is a grant of probate or letters of administration.
If you need assistance with the application only, the main distinction is whether there is an inheritance tax liability.
Probate, application only: no inheritance tax payable
Our fixed fee service is only suitable for matters concerning an estate where assets are passed or preserved without incurring an inheritance tax liability.
Our legal fee of £2500 (plus VAT) covers only an application to the probate registry, based on information provided by you, the client, as the executor of the estate.
We will not engage in correspondence with parties other than executor(s). Should you wish for us to liaise with creditors, debtors, beneficiaries or other interested parties: this may incur an additional fee and will be discussed with you before we proceed.
Probate, application only: with inheritance tax liability
During our initial meeting, please bring as much information as possible concerning the deceased and their estate. Our Private Client solicitors will use this information to confirm the inheritance tax liability based on the approximate value of the estate. The information will help us to prepare an estimate as to the time required to process the application in its entirety, noting that multiple schedules may be required to account for the multitude of assets within the estate.
Our legal fee covers only the preparation and submission of the application to the probate registry. We will rely on information provided by you, the client, as executor of the estate. The fee will be estimated based on the range and value of assets involved, as this will determine the time that will be required to collate the necessary information and complete the forms.
Alternatively, you may wish to engage us to prepare and submit the application followed by completing administration of the estate either in accordance with the Will and letter of wishes or the laws of intestacy.
Probate: full estate administration
If you require support for all elements of administration and communication following the death of a loved one, we offer a comprehensive service. We can complete or assist with all aspects of estate handling, including funeral arrangements, notification processes, asset valuations leading to probate application preparation. Our private client solicitors can also manage the calling in of all funds and relevant distribution.
Our legal fees in this form of instruction cover all time needed to fully finalise the estate of the deceased. We would ask only that you provide all information you have to hand as soon as possible upon our instruction, to ensure an accurate time-cost estimate in a timely manner. If our legal fee estimate changes during the course of our instruction, we will keep you updated accordingly.
Additional costs to note: disbursements
- Probate application – £300
- Additional copies – £1.50 per copy
- Financial profile search – minimum £195 (plus VAT)
- London Gazette s27 advert – £98 (plus VAT)
- Local newspaper s27 notice(s) – can vary, but will be advised of before confirmed and cost incurred
